Kekrajhola Population - Rajnandgaon, Chhattisgarh
Kekrajhola is a very small village located in Chhuikhadan Tehsil of Rajnandgaon district, Chhattisgarh with total 1 families residing. The Kekrajhola village has population of 4 of which 3 are males while 1 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kekrajhola village population of children with age 0-6 is 0 which makes up 0.00 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kekrajhola village is 333 which is lower than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Kekrajhola as per census is 0, lower than Chhattisgarh average of 969.
Kekrajhola village has lower liter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Kekrajhola village was 0.00 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Kekrajhola Male literacy stands at 0.00 % while female literacy rate was 0.00 %.

Kekrajhola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 1 | - | - |
Population | 4 | 3 | 1 |
Child (0-6)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 4 | 3 | 1 |
Literacy | 0.00 % | 0.00 % | 0.00 % |
Total Workers | 4 | 3 | 1 |
Main Worker | 1 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 3 | 2 | 1 |
